LHU Lacrosse's Megan Dwyer Earns All-America Honors

   
  (Lock Haven, Pa.) -  Megan Dwyer (Collegeville, Pa./ Perkiomen Valley), a lacrosse player for Lock Haven University of Pennsylvania, earned selection as a Brine/IWLCA US Lacrosse Division II Second Team All-American.  She is the fourth All-American in LHU lacrosse history and the first since the 1998 season.
            The junior attacker nabbed All-America accolades along with Second Team All-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C) Offense honors after leading Lady Eagle scoring with 60 total points.  Dwyer posted 37 goals along with a team-best 23 assists, and added points on the scoreboard in all but one contest this season.  She tied the school record for assists in a season (23), and in the process, became Lock Haven's all-time assists leader with 40 over her three-year career.
            The Lady Eagle lacrosse team finished the year with a 7-9 overall record and a fourth-place finish in the PSAC with a 3-3 ledger.
